荆门托远传媒广告有限公司

股票代碼:603516

淺談分布式系統(tǒng)的光網(wǎng)鏈路備份

2020-09-11

系統(tǒng)的穩(wěn)定性是衡量一款分布式產(chǎn)品優(yōu)劣的核心指標,如何提高系統(tǒng)穩(wěn)定性是各大分布式廠商關注的重點,在完善產(chǎn)品自身運行的穩(wěn)定性的基礎上,大家將目光紛紛投向了「系統(tǒng)備份」。光網(wǎng)鏈路備份是目前市面上主流的備份方案,針對同樣的光網(wǎng)鏈路備份系統(tǒng),即使物理鏈路完全一致,如果采用不同的處理機制,最終呈現(xiàn)的效果也截然不同。是什么影響了備份系統(tǒng)的使用效果,下面我們來解析分布式產(chǎn)品實現(xiàn)光網(wǎng)鏈路備份的不同方式。


單鏈路切換備份

顧名思義,單鏈路意味著光網(wǎng)兩條鏈路同一時刻只有一條鏈路有碼流在傳輸,當主鏈路發(fā)生故障時,輸入節(jié)點需要將碼流切換到備用鏈路重新協(xié)商傳輸才能實現(xiàn)備份功能,具體切換過程如下:

單.gif

如上圖所示,當主傳輸鏈路中出現(xiàn)了故障,顯示器重新顯示正常畫面底層需要經(jīng)過四個階段:

1.? ?檢測網(wǎng)絡故障

2.???重建網(wǎng)絡連接(1S)

3.? ?協(xié)商數(shù)據(jù)傳輸(2-3S)

4.???完成主備切換

可以看到,由于備用鏈路沒有實時傳輸碼流,主鏈路故障后,需要重新建立網(wǎng)絡連接和協(xié)商數(shù)據(jù)傳輸,整個主備切換過程耗時3~4秒,這段時間內,顯示器畫面會呈現(xiàn)靜幀或黑屏狀態(tài),效果不佳。盡管如此,因為單鏈路切換技術成本較低,實現(xiàn)簡單,目前市面上,絕大部分廠商使用的都是這種光網(wǎng)鏈路備份方式。


雙鏈路實時備份

介于單鏈路切換備份的部分劣勢,雙鏈路實時備份技術應運而生,實時備份技術下,主備兩條鏈路同時在傳輸相同的碼流,當主鏈路故障后,輸出節(jié)點直接選擇備用鏈路的碼流進行顯示輸出,具體過程如下:

雙02.gif

如上圖所示,當主傳輸鏈路中出現(xiàn)了故障,顯示器重新顯示正常畫面需要以下兩個步驟:

1.? 主數(shù)據(jù)中斷
2. ?備數(shù)據(jù)切換顯示(10ms)

可以看到,由于備用鏈路一直在傳輸碼流,不需要重新建立網(wǎng)絡連接和協(xié)商數(shù)據(jù)傳輸,網(wǎng)絡從中斷到解碼端視頻正常輸出只需要約10ms的時間,肉眼很難看到切換痕跡,真正實現(xiàn)了實時備份的功能。不過由于該技術開發(fā)難度大,成本高,只有極少數(shù)廠商才能做到。


淳中科技實拍效果

為了更直觀的展示雙鏈路實時備份的效果,我們實拍了淳中科技NYX雙引擎分布式系統(tǒng)的切換過程供大家參考。

0910輸出01.gif

如上圖所示,雙鏈路實時備份下,當斷掉一條鏈路的碼流輸入后,輸出節(jié)點瞬間選擇另一條鏈路的碼流顯示輸出,顯示器畫面無縫切換,真正做到了無感知的備份切換。


淳中科技將繼續(xù)堅持技術創(chuàng)新,在分布式領域深耕,不斷完善分布式系統(tǒng)在各場景平臺的應用,為更多的行業(yè)用戶提供真正實用且優(yōu)質的音視頻顯控解決方案。

宁武县| 桦南县| 平乐县| 齐齐哈尔市| 河津市| 仪陇县| 观塘区| 师宗县| 毕节市| 镇坪县| 平顶山市| 石门县| 秦皇岛市| 安溪县| 焦作市| 佛冈县| 柞水县| 德令哈市| 岳阳县| 麻栗坡县| 梅河口市| 淳安县| 富阳市| 临猗县| 武清区| 昭通市| 阜阳市| 莒南县| 伊吾县| 益阳市| 巴楚县| 乌兰浩特市| 北票市| 霍州市| 农安县| 黑龙江省| 静乐县| 息烽县| 资源县| 南和县| 桃江县|